I just wanted to clarify a few things about Alice Deejay... Alice Deejay is a collective of Dutch DJs and Producers who write and produce tracks for singer Judy. For the live-act Judy is joined by dancers Mila and Angel.
=========================================================
The Alice Deejay collective consists of the following DJs/Producers:
>> Pronti = Sebastiaan Molijn
>> Kalmani = Eelke Kalberg
>> DJ Jurgen = Jurgen Rijkers
>> Danski = Dennis van den Driesschen
>> DJ Delmundo = Wessel van Diepen
>> Svenson = Sven Maes
>> Johan Gielen
>> Michiel Van der Kuy
>> DJ Isaac = Roel Schutrups
>> Hazerdous = ???
NOTE: Pronti & Kalmani are also the writers/producers behind the Vengaboys.

The following tracklisting for "Who Needs Guitars Anyways?" lists the writing and production credits for each track on the CD.
=========================================================
Alice Deejay - Who Needs Guitars Anyway?
1. Back In My Life, Written and Produced by: Pronti & Kalmani.
2. Better Off Alone, Written and Produced by: Pronti & Kalmani.
3. Celebrate Our Love, Written and Produced by: Pronti & Kalmani.
4. The Lonely One, Written and Produced by: S. Maes & Gielen.
5. Who Needs Guitars Anyway?, Written and Produced by: Danski & DJ Delmundo.
6. Will I Ever, Written and Produced by: Danski & DJ Delmundo.
7. Elements Of Life, Written and Produced by: M. van der Kuy / R. Schutrups / Danski & DJ Delmundo.
8. Fairytales, Written and Produced by: Pronti & Kalmani.
9. Waiting For Your Love, Written and Produced by: M. van der Kuy / R. Schutrups.
10. No More Lies, Written and Produced by: S. Maes & J. Gielen.
11. I Can See (Se It In Your Eyes), Written and Produced by:
M. van der Kuy / R. Schutrups.
12. Everything Begins With An E, Written and Produced by:
M. van der Kuy / R. Schutrups.
13. Got To Get Away Written, by Hazerdous / Danski & DJ Delmundo, Produced by: Hazerdous.
14. Alice Deejay, Written and Produced by: M. van der Kuy / R. Schutrups.
=========================================================
Although it's not mentioned in the above tracklisting I read on the internet that DJ Jurgen was involved with the production of "Better Off Alone".
Since Pronti & Kalmani wrote and produced Alice Deejay's two biggest club hits that most people are familiar with, as well as being the writers/producers behind the Vengaboys, when people say they hate Alice Deejay, they usually really mean and should be saying that they hate Pronti & Kalmani.
